Police seeking man’s family

Police are seeking the assistance of the public in locating the family members of an elderly man, who appears to be in his sixties.

He was found in the area of Bonnets, Britton Hill, St Michael, sometime around 10:47 p.m. on Sunday, February 11.

He has identified himself as Grantley Beckles, and is approximately 5 feet 6 inches tall, of medium build and dark complexion. He also walks with a cane, and both of his legs appear to be swollen. He is wearing an orange and blue plaid shirt, a red ¾ pants, and a pair of black and white slippers.

His family members, or anyone who may know his family members, are being asked to contact the Hastings Police Station at 430-7612 or 430-7608. (PR)
